    Same question was being asked about Kofi Kingston months back. It's WWE's way of booking, they push a guy to the upper midcard and test the waters. It's a good system imo as it gives alot of guys chances to prove themselves and makes the fans take them more seriously then jobbers. Before The Miz it was Kofi, before Kofi it was MVP and the list goes on. I don't think he's being burried, more they pushed him to see if he'd catch on and he obviously didn't as much as they wanted so now he'll move back down the card a little bit so the next Miz/Kofi/MVP can have a little run. I can make a huge list of guys that have been booked exactly the same way in the past and it was not because they were on WWE creative's **** list.
